Can A Financial Analyst Afford Rent in Brighton, MI?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 27.2% of gross income.

Brighton r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Michigan state estimate).

Brighton median rent
$2,246/mo
Financial Analyst salary (Michigan)
$99,206/yr
Rent as % of income
27.2%
Gross monthly income works out to about $8,267, and the 30% rule supports up to $2,480/mo in rent. Brighton's median rent of $2,246 leaves roughly $234/mo of headroom under that threshold. A financial analyst works roughly 47.1 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Michigan state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Brighton, MI.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
